Polyfunctional

Polyfunctional is an adjective used to describe something that has or performs more than one function. In science and technology, the term is applied across disciplines to denote multiple capabilities, roles, or activities within a single entity. Its precise meaning depends on context, but it generally highlights versatility rather than a single, isolated function.
